Given that he’s been so disappointing so far this season and given that he has one or two wayward quirks, many of you might think I’m bonkers for napping Luca Cumani’s grey. But I cannot resist granting him one last chance in the hope that a proper stamina test (longer trip on testing ground) resurrects his best form. Cumani had high hopes of Spifer after a promising three-year-old campaign last summer when he looked like developing into a Group horse over middle distances. But his tendency to hang led to a gelding operation, from which he might still have been recovering when running flat at Pontefract last time. Since then, he’s enjoyed a ten-week break and goes into this race on the same handicap mark as when runner-up in a warm affair at Ascot a year ago. As the son of one Derby winner (Motivator) out of the daughter of another (Kahyasi), there’s certainly nothing wrong with his pedigree! In-form trainer Cumani also boasts a fine one-in-four strike-rate at this track, while the gelding certainly won’t lack for assistance in the saddle, courtesy of Kieren Fallon.
